Johanna Thiebaud’s Early Life and Rise in the Music World
Born on August 5, 1992, in San Francisco, California, Johanna Thiebaud was immersed in creativity from the very beginning. As the only child of a musician father and an artist mother, Johanna’s environment naturally fostered a deep appreciation for the arts. That artistic influence took root early—she began writing songs at just eight years old, and soon after, she picked up the piano and guitar.
By her teenage years, Johanna was no longer just a hobbyist. She performed regularly at open mic nights and local coffeehouses, gaining experience and confidence as a live performer.
After graduating high school, Johanna took the next step toward her dream by enrolling in Berklee College of Music in Boston, Massachusetts, where she majored in music composition. It was there she connected with future collaborators, including acclaimed producer and songwriter Ian Kirkpatrick.
Following her time at Berklee, Johanna and her bandmates relocated to Los Angeles to immerse themselves in the heart of the music industry. The move marked a turning point in her career.
In LA, Johanna quickly established herself as a versatile and in-demand talent. While focusing on her own original music, she also began working as a session vocalist and songwriter for other artists. Her vocal range, tone, and songwriting ability caught the attention of major figures in the industry—most notably Grammy-winning producer Greg Kurstin, known for his work with Adele, Beck, and Ellie Goulding. Kurstin praised Johanna as “an incredible singer with a great range and tone,” reinforcing her reputation as a rising star in a highly competitive scene.
